NEW YORK, Sept. 26,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- KraneShares, a leading provider of exchange-traded funds (ETFs) delivering access to emerging technologies and innovative global asset classes, today announced that the KraneShares Artificial Intelligence & Technology ETF (Nasdaq: AGIX) has been added to LPL Financial’s No-Transaction-Fee (NTF) platform, expanding accessibility for LPL’s more than 22,000 financial advisors and their clients.

LPL Financial is the largest independent broker-dealer and a leading provider of investment and business solutions to financial advisors across the United States. Its NTF platform allows advisors to offer a curated range of ETFs and mutual funds without incurring transaction charges, improving cost efficiency for investors. However, investors are still responsible for the ongoing expenses of the ETFs, such as management fees and other operating costs.

AGIX: A New Approach to AI Investing
AGIX offers a blended approach to AI exposure :

  • Private AI Leaders: Exposure to private artificial intelligence companies such as Anthropic (3.92% weight in AGIX) and xAI (1.97% weight in AGIX) 1 , offering investors a chance to participate in early-stage innovation typically limited to venture capital and private equity investors.
  • Public Market Innovators: Allocations to publicly listed companies involved in the AI ecosystem—from semiconductors and cloud infrastructure to software and application layers—helping investors capture the full value chain of AI adoption.

“Artificial intelligence is positioned as a significant growth opportunity in this decade,” said Derek Yan, CFA, Senior Investment Strategist at KraneShares. “AGIX allows investors to gain exposure not only to the household names of AI but also emerging companies—both public and private—participating in this technological transformation.”

Coinciding with AGIX’s addition to LPL’s NTF platform, KraneShares will host a live webinar on Tuesday, October 7, 2025 , titled “Anthropic’s Surge & The Potential Benefits of Pre-IPO Exposure in AI ETFs.” The session will feature speakers from Etna Capital Partners and KraneShares, covering the outlook for public and private AI markets, key developments from companies like Anthropic and xAI, and a review of AGIX’s positioning and performance. KraneShares’ Broader Presence on the LPL Platform
KraneShares joined the LPL NTF platform in January 2025 and now offers 13 ETFs spanning emerging technologies, carbon markets, China exposure, and income solutions. These include:

  • China: KWEB (China Internet), KURE (China Healthcare), KGRN (China Clean Technology), KSTR (STAR Market), KBA (China A-Shares)
  • Options Income: KLIP
  • Carbon Credits: KRBN
  • Fixed Income & U.S. Equity: IVOL, BNDD, KVLE
  • Global Technology & Emerging Markets: AGIX, KARS (Electric Vehicles), KEMQ, KEMX

The expansion of KraneShares’ products on the NTF platform coincides with the firm’s strategic partnership with InspereX, further enhancing distribution into LPL’s advisor network.

AGIX may invest in derivatives, which are often more volatile than other investments and may magnify AGIX's gains or losses. A derivative (i.e., futures/forward contracts, swaps, and options) is a contract that derives its value from the performance of an underlying asset. The primary risk of derivatives is that changes in the asset’s market value and the derivative may not be proportionate, and some derivatives can have the potential for unlimited losses. Derivatives are also subject to liquidity and counterparty risk. AGIX is subject to liquidity risk, meaning that certain investments may become difficult to purchase or sell at a reasonable time and price. If a transaction for these securities is large, it may not be possible to initiate, which may cause AGIX to suffer losses. Counterparty risk is the risk of loss in the event that the counterparty to an agreement fails to make required payments or otherwise comply with the terms of the derivative.

ETF shares are bought and sold on an exchange at market price (not NAV) and are not individually redeemed from the Fund. However, shares may be redeemed at NAV directly by certain authorized broker-dealers (Authorized Participants) in very large creation/redemption units. The returns shown do not represent the returns you would receive if you traded shares at other times. Shares may trade at a premium or discount to their NAV in the secondary market. Brokerage commissions will reduce returns. Beginning 12/23/2020, market price returns are based on the official closing price of an ETF share or, if the official closing price isn't available, the midpoint between the national best bid and national best offer ("NBBO") as of the time the ETF calculates the current NAV per share. Prior to that date, market price returns were based on the midpoint between the Bid and Ask price. NAVs are calculated using prices as of 4:00 PM Eastern Time.
